1) Planning

Planning is the key to development and success for any business. It is a great way to clarify your goals, check on your progress, and track your achievements. Goals allow you to get out of your comfort zones and take calculated risks.

Set yourself short and long-term with planning. The more you will extend and challenge yourself, the more you will attain your business. Once you've drawn up your new business plan and put it into practice, it needs to be monitored continuously to ensure the objectives are achieved level. This review process should assess your progress to date and analyze the most ways to develop your business successfully.

2) Increase your productivity

If your employees are content, their output will increase, and that's precisely what is required to help your business to boost. Making minor modifications to habits will improve the levels of productivity and office efficiency in your business.

Be open to change and consider how your business is currently working and if it needs any potential changes. Provide each employee with a chart for the day and encourage them to complete the prioritized tasks on time but make sure to set realistic goals for them. Delivering employees with the right tools and equipment is essential so they can carry out their duties on time.

4) Hiring employees

Planning and thinking about hiring the next generation of workers is important for your business to grow. To select the best workers for your business, research the potential strengths and weaknesses of the particular person you are looking for. Revisit the interview questions you usually ask and add the questions that best highlight the candidate’s skills.
